Sydney Thunder vs Brisbane Heat 25th Match Scorecard | BBL 14
Full Scorecard: Dan Christianย rewound the clock in his first match since retiring. Still, Matt Renshawย andย Max Bryantย produced a blistering century partnership to lift Brisbane Heat over Sydney Thunder in a pivotal BBL result.
Chasing 174 at the Gabba, the Heat were in big trouble at 43 for 3 before Bryant and Renshaw combined for a belligerent 108-run partnership to turn the match on its head. Bryant smashed 72 off 35 balls, while Renshaw whacked 48 not out off 33 balls as Heat reached the target with seven balls to spare.
It was a vital win for the Heat, who reignited their title defense and moved to a 3-3 (one no result) record. After their attack fell apart in the backend of Heat’s innings, with quick Wes Agar suffering the brunt with 1 for 61 from 3.5 overs, the shorthanded Thunder (4-2) missed their chance to claim the top spot on the BBL ladder.
